Output afa2386fbbf07cdcc55e124cffcc766733c062c3bbd5fc669f1f690bf9461fec:1

value
13945
script pubkey
OP_0 OP_PUSHBYTES_20 c3010fbec5b8db0333790a2825860f9b3de66af1
address
bc1qcvqsl0k9hrdsxvmepg5ztps0nv77v6h3ulaysu
transaction
afa2386fbbf07cdcc55e124cffcc766733c062c3bbd5fc669f1f690bf9461fec
confirmations
351880
spent
true